Lalu Prasad & Congress not allow Panchayat elections for 23 years, deprived of reservation: Sushil

Patna Aur 17 ( UNI) Rajya Sabha MP Sushil Kumar Modi on Wednesday alleged that RJD chief Lalu Prasad Yadav and Congress did not allow Panchayat elections to be held for 23 years in Bihar and deprived people of various categories from reservation.
Mr Modi through his tweet said that even when the Lalu government conducted elections, it did not give reservation to the SC-ST category in posts like Mukhiya-Pramukh.
He said that blood shed which was common during elections and maintained that more than 150 people were killed during electoral violence.
